Mishima vs Ouanaham Climate & Distance Between

New Caledonia flag
  • The distance between Mishima, Japan and Ouanaham, New Caledonia is approximately 6,896 km or 4,285 mi.
  • To reach Mishima in this distance one would set out from Ouanaham bearing 333.9° or NNW and follow the great circles arc to approach Mishima bearing 329.9° or NNW .
  • Mishima has a humid subtropical climate (Cfa) whereas Ouanaham has a tropical rainforest climate (Af).
  • The annual mean temperature is 7.4 °C (13.3°F) cooler.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 15 °C (27°F) more in Mishima. The continentality subtype is subcontinental as opposed to truly hyperoceanic.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 106.8 mm (4.2 in) more which is equivalent to 106.8 l/m² (2.62 US gal/ft²) or 1,068,000 l/ha (114,176 US gal/ac) more. About 1 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 12.8° lower in Mishima than in Ouanaham.
